This practical book explains childrens understanding of death at different ages and gives a detailed outline of how adults can best help them cope with death, whether it is a parent, sibling, or other relative, friend, classmate, or teacher who has died. Creating a tribute photo book for a loved one is not only a great memento for your family for years to come, but the project itself can be a helpful mourning practice.
